National Nurses Week

SILVER SPRING, Md. — National Nurses Week is observed May 6th through May 12th to recognize nursing professionals for their dedication and commitment to advancing health care. The observance is organized by the American Nurses Association. This week of recognition concludes on the birthday of Florence Nightingale, the founder of modern nursing, and serves as a vital period for healthcare facilities to highlight the essential role these professionals play in patient outcomes and community wellness.
